Honey Recommended for Use in Skin Grafts

 

 

 

A Different and Safe Method of Split Thickness Skin Graft Fixation:

Medical Honey Application

 

Burns, 2007 Jun 28

Honey has been used for medicinal purposes since ancient times. Its

antibacterial effects have been established during the past few decades.

Still, modern medical practitioners hesitate to apply honey for local

treatment of wounds. This may be because of the expected messiness of

such local application. Hence, if honey is to be used for medicinal

purposes, it has to meet certain criteria.

 

 

 

The authors evaluated its use for the split thickness skin graft

fixation because of its adhesive and other beneficial effects in 11

patients. No complications such as graft loss, infection, and graft

rejection were seen. Based on these results, the authors advised honey

as a new agent for split thickness skin graft fixation…
